What it actually says
Create a new discord.py Cog for this project. Follow the add-cog skill for the full checklist.
The Cog name should be: $ARGUMENTS
Steps:
- Read the
.claude/skills/add-cog/SKILL.mdskill for the complete pattern - Create the Cog file at
claude_discord/cogs/{name}.py - Export from
claude_discord/cogs/__init__.pyandclaude_discord/__init__.py - Create tests at
tests/test_{name}.py - Run the verify command to ensure everything passes
